The purchase of the operating assets of a magnet and electric motor shop in South Bend, Indiana in 2000 led to the foundation of Magnetech Industrial Services, Inc., a wholly owned subsidiary of MISCOR Group.

Purchased Meade Industrial
In August 2001 with the purchase of Meade Industrial, locations and capabilities were added in Hammond, Indiana and Boardman, Ohio.
Acquired Huntington

Acquired 3-D Service
With the acquisition of the privately held 3-D Service in 2007, a service center in Massillon, Ohio was added, and the Magnetech corporate headquarters were moved from South Bend, Indiana to Massillon, Ohio, to align the headquarters with the largest facility within the company.
MISCOR Was Purchased By IES
Magnetech’s parent company was purchased by IES Holdings, Inc.(IES) in September 2013, becoming a wholly owned subsidiary of IES. Magnetech Industrial Services, Southern Rewinding, Calumet Armature Electric, Technibus and Freeman Enclosure Systems form the IES Infrastructure Solutions division under IES.
